http://www.yes24.com/Product/Goods/59461086
⌜Do it! 자바스크립트 + 제이쿼리 입문⌟ 책을 공부하며 요약・정리한 내용입니다.
수학 객체의 메서드 및 상수
종류 설명
Math.abs(숫자) | 숫자의 절대값을 반환합니다. |
Math.max(숫자1, 숫자2, 숫자3) | 숫자 중 가장 큰값을 반환합니다. |
Math.min(숫자1, 숫자2, 숫자3) | 숫자 중 가장 작은 값을 반환합니다. |
Math.pow(숫자, 제곱값) | 숫자의 거듭제곱값을 반환합니다. |
Math.random() | 0~1 사이의 난수를 반환합니다. |
Math.round(숫자) | 소수점 첫째 자리에서 반올림하여 정수를 반환합니다. |
Math.ceil(숫자) | 소수점 첫째 자리에서 무조건 올림하여 정수를 반환합니다. |
Math.floor(숫자) | 소수점 첫째 자리에서 무조건 내림하여 정수를 반환합니다. |
Math.sqrt(숫자) | 숫자의 제곱근값을 반환합니다. |
Math.PI | 원주율 상수를 반환합니다. |
e.g.
let num = 2.1234;
let maxNum = Math.max(10, 5, 8, 30),
roundNum = Math.round(num),
rndNum = Math.random();
cf) 난수를 발생하여 원하는 구간 정수의 값 구하기
Math.floor(Math.random()*(최댓값-최솟값+1))+최솟값;
부족하거나 잘못된 내용이 있을 경우 댓글 달아주시면 감사하겠습니다.
이 글에 부족한 부분이 존재할 경우 추후에 수정될 수 있습니다.
'JavaScript > JavaScript' 카테고리의 다른 글
자바스크립트 문자열 객체 (0) | 2022.07.22 |
---|---|
자바스크립트 배열 객체 (0) | 2022.07.22 |
자바스크립트 날짜 정보 객체 (0) | 2022.07.21 |
자바스크립트 조건식에 논리형 데이터가 아닌 다른 형이 오는 경우 (0) | 2022.07.21 |
null & undefined & typeof & 비교연산자 (0) | 2022.07.20 |